Research on capsule for recolonizing lactobacillus after BV hits snag. (Used with Single dose of Metronidazole).

From: OB GYN News | Date: October 1, 2002| Author: Demott, Kathryn | Copyright information

BANFF, ALTA. -- Plans to offer women with bacterial vaginosis an intravaginal capsule for recolonizing lactobacillus are on hold despite its 88% success rate in those who use it with metronidazole, Sharon Hillier, Ph.D., reported at the annual meeting of the Infectious Diseases Society for Obstetrics and Gynecology.
